Welcome to Study In Austria Website

 

This website has been created to promote higher education among Pakistani students by removing the barrier of 'Ignorance' about educational system of Austria. Presently students in Pakistan have very limited information about Austria in general and about their educational system in particular. One reason why Austrian Universities are not very well known is because Austrians have not done the 'marketing' of their Universities and their educational system as many other countries do. This website is an effort to answer all relevant questions about life and education in Austria. It will help the students in two ways. First, those students who have received a scholarship for studies in Austria would be better prepared. Secondly, those students who are interested in pursuing education in Austria will be able to make an informed decision. Furthermore, this website will also specially help those scholars who are coming to Austria through the Higher Education Commission scholarship program.

Some of you may think 'Why Austria'? Why not go to USA, England, China or Australia. That's a good question. We are not the promoters of Austrian educational system but here is our honest opinion

  • The quality of education is really good. The Austrian Universities offer a world class environment and facilities to their students and are comparable to any other European Universities. At the PhD level, they offer the most important "freedom of thought" and "self-finalised time lines" for the scholars to give them the required expertise and confidence.
  • The opportunity to work on collaborative projects on a Europe wide level, gives scholars the chance to widen their horizons and increase their productivity, besides the necessary skills of correspondence and persuasion.
  • Education is FREE. People coming from developing countries do not have to pay the EURO 750/- per semester fee. The policy, however varies from University to University so it is important to check with the University where you are interested in studying.
  • Cost of living is comparatively cheaper. Although in Vienna it may be expensive as it's the capital city.
  • Good health insurance system. It only costs EURO 22/- per month which even includes the whole family. Up to some extent Dental treatment is also included in this price. If you don't think it's a bargain then compare it to approx. US $400/ month that you will have to pay to get similar coverage excluding dental treatment.
  • You get the opportunity to learn German language. The 10th most spoken language in the world which apart from Germany and Austria is spoken in Belgium, Bolivia, Czech Rep., Denmark, Hungary, Italy, Kazakhstan, Liechtenstein, Luxembourg, Paraguay, Poland, Romania, Slovakia and Switzerland. Almost 10% of the books are published in this language. Last but not least is that you open a big job market for yourself.
  • You have Pakistani scholars in almost all the cities of Austria who can help you in settling down.
